mysql只能用127001访问 mysql只能写数字

大家好,请问一下mysql的无符号字段类型是不是只能存储正数?存储人民...【mysql只能用127001访问 mysql只能写数字】存储人民币金额应该使用DECIMAL类型,保证存储和计算的精确性 。如果确保金额不会包含小数部分 , 可以使用INT类型 。绝对不可以使用浮点类型 。
mysql的字段类型大体来讲分为int、text、varchar、char、blog等几种 , 而各自的类型中又划分了不同的字符数的类型,mediumint是MySQL数据库中的一种数据类型,比INT小,比SMALLINT大 。
大整数 。带符号的范围是-9223372036854775808到9223372036854775807 。无符号的范围是0到18446744073709551615 。
UNSIGNED 修饰符规定字段只保存正值 。因为不需要保存数字的正、负符号,可以在储时节约一个“位”的空间 。从而增大这个字段可以存储的值的范围 。ZEROFILL 修饰符规定 0(不是空格)可以用来真补输出的值 。
我的mysql中的类型是varchar啊,但是还是插入不了字母,只能是数字,为什么...这是SQL语句错误 , 插入字符串的话,变量必须包含在引号内 。
你得看看你的数据库的字符编码是不是UTF-8的,因为默认建库建表是latin字符编码 。
mysql让输入的数据只能是数字和字母具体操作如下 。表中的四列表头默认的数据类型都是int,右键修改列信息 , 将需要带字母显示的列格式改为varchar(20),也就是改变数据类型,这样正常插入带字母的数据了 。
此外 , varchar 的最大长度也受限于行长度,行长度即所有列的长度和,行长度限制为65535字节;因此,如有很多列,实际可定义的列长度会受影响 。2 注意事项二 , 当出现注意事项一中的情况下,可使用text类型代替varchar 。
(php环境)为什么mysql数据库中只能插入数字,不能插入中英文1、编码问题,SQL默认貌似是UTF-8 易语言的编辑框貌似是BGK简体 。
2、解决中文插入数据库乱码的方法:直接把中文转变成utf-8格式,大多是这个问题导致的 。
3、插入字符串的话,变量必须包含在引号内 。你的外部引号是双引号 ,所以可以这样写$sql=INSERT INTO $tablename1 (fund_name1,fund_name2) VALUES ($ftitle1,$ftitle2);这段代码 同时适合数字插入 。
4、在Linux中 , 使用终端方式登陆MySQL服务器 , 运行以下命令:set names utf8;该命令将终端的字符编码设为了UTF-8 。此后再插入数据库中的内容都会按照UTF-8的编码来处理 。
5、因为中文Windows系统默认的字符集不是UTF-8的 , 所以不能在命令行输入包含中文的SQL语句,只能找个类似phpAdmin的数据库客户端,设置字符集为UTF-8才能输入包含中文的SQL语句 。

    推荐阅读